  • 2nd Generation iPod Nano Dead?

    My 2nd generation iPod Nano was working fine this morning. Played music as it did for all these years. Later this afternoon I turned it on and the display would not light up. No music played. Seems like the battery is totally drained. Plugged into USB wall charger (from Apple) and get no indication whethr or not this thing is charging. Same when I plugged into my Mac. Does not show up in iTunes or on the desktop.
    Is my iPod Nano Dead? Has the battery bitten the dust and cannot be recharged again? It's a shame that none of these iPods have user replaceable batteries... Other than being dead I am quite sure that if I could put in a new battery it would work again. I don't like spending a lot of money for something that does not last me at least 10 years.

    If the iPod's battery has been fully drained it can at least 30 minutes or more of charging for the iPod to show any signs of life and even after that a hard reset might be required. To reset the Nano, press and hold both the Select?Center and Menu buttons together long enough for the Apple logo to appear.

  • Nano , Dead .    My  holidays start  Saturday ,please help

    Hello, I have just started re-organising my iPod for holidays that start this Saturday when after updating to the latest software 1.3.1 ,
    EDIT>>I clicked restore and the screen displayed 'extracting software' then I noticed the screen go dark the Apple logo show up then the progress bar went across a little (i didnt see if it finished) then from top to bottom the screen went blank, kinda just wiped or something
    I looked at it and it was dead ,blank screen and not recognized in iTunes .
    I left it for a bit then tried turning it on and nothing
    please, would someone come to my rescue, I'd really appreciate some help
    -becca

    UPDATE.
    Thank heavens for Macuser magazine from the UK, they had the 'how to' re the hard reset .
    I thiught maybe a battery issue so I tried plugging the nano into my apple dock after the hard reset and BINGO!! came on and started charging and fired up .
    To perform the hard re set on a first gen Nano you simply hold the top(menu) button and the middle (select)button and hold for about 5 seconds and there you go .
    hope this helps any one searching for an issue with a dead Nano in the future

  • Soaked nano

    My year-and-a-half-old nano was in my backpack (in what I naively assumed was a waterproof partition) and was totally soaked in a rainstorm early Friday morning. At that time, it was displaying an error message that I can't quite recall, about Firewire (?) and needing to be connected to the USB. I dried it off as best I could, and left it alone for 24 hours. This morning, pressing the button in the centre had no effect, so I plugged the USB charger into it. It's been plugged in for about two hours now, and it's still giving me the "Please wait - Very low battery" screen.
    Am I totally out of luck here? Have I killed my nano dead?

    Your Nano may already have been damaged by plugging it into a power source while still wet, however try putting it in a warm place and let it dry out naturally for about a week. Do not connect it to your computer or any other power source during that time. After that charge it up and you may, I stress may be fortunate enough to get it working again.
